About Abidemi J. Akindele

Abidemi J. Akindele is a scholar working on Complementary and alternative medicine, Pharmacology and Endocrinology, Diabetes and Metabolism, having authored 83 papers that have together received 1.4k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Ethnobotanical and Medicinal Plants Studies (23 papers), Natural Antidiabetic Agents Studies (21 papers), Phytochemistry and Biological Activities (10 papers), Drug-Induced Hepatotoxicity and Protection (9 papers), Advances in Cucurbitaceae Research (7 papers), Medicinal Plants and Neuroprotection (6 papers), Botanical Research and Chemistry (6 papers) and Natural product bioactivities and synthesis (6 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Pharmacology (394 citations), Complementary and alternative medicine (254 citations) and Endocrinology, Diabetes and Metabolism (274 citations). Abidemi J. Akindele has collaborated with scholars based in Nigeria, India and South Africa. Frequent co-authors include OO Adeyemi, Olufunmilayo O. Adeyemi, Ismail O. Ishola, Margaret O. Sofidiya, Oludele Awodele, Olufunsho Awodele, Dhirendra Kumar Singh, Omoniyi K. Yemitan, Naresh K. Satti and Olufemi Morakinyo. Their work appears in journals such as S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ología, Scientific Reports and Journal of Ethnopharmacology.
